I have an 02 Silverado k1500 with noise coming from front end. Noise occurs when when I hit a bump or dip in the road, and also when steering wheel is turned both in drive and reverse. Sounds like something is hitting right under floor board of drivers side. I put the truck on jacks and checked it out but couldn't see anything. Any help would be appreciated.

Thanks. I found the problem to be both my lower ball joint bushings are blown. Drove truck from Alaska to states, long rough road. Won't hold grease, and are split open on the backside where it is hard to see but you can feel them. Does anyone know if they make polyeurethane kits for a 2002 K1500. I have been looking, but only finding kits for older model chevy's.
